Fake Married to the Grumps #2

Marrying the Bad Boy Next Door

Rate this book
My best friend’s brother ghosted me after I confessed my feelings. Now he’s back and this time, he wants to marry me…

Movie star Bryce Alston is a gorgeous, grumpy, misunderstood bad boy. His brooding gaze masks a rugged charm, constantly making my heart race. I thought I’d moved on after he broke my heart. But now he’s back like nothing happened, becoming my next-door neighbor and my boss. As if dodging his smoldering gazes isn’t hard enough, he announces that we're getting married when the media sharks are chasing after him. I still can’t say no to him. Pretending to love my childhood crush is easy, as long as I guard my heart. But the way his arm gently brushes mine sends tingles down my spine. I survived losing him once before. I can’t do it another time. But when his lips claim mine, I’m not sure who is falling…

Marrying the Bad Boy Next Door is a sweet standalone, closed-door romance, brimming with sizzling chemistry without the spice.

4.5 stars rounded to 5

Bryce Alston, is a celebrity bad boy actor who has come back to his hometown to make a movie. Marissa Hansley is his sister's best friend and happens to work for the film production company that he is contracted with. As soon as he sees her name on the list of possible assistants he can choose, he jumps at the chance to be able to work with and be around her again. They were secret childhood friends for years but all of that ended in tears and regrets with no explanation. Now, it's been eight years...will working closely together heal old wounds or make them worse?

There is so much packed into this story. I devoured it in one day because I just couldn't put it down! There's troubled pasts, family drama, big emotions, sizzling chemistry and swoon worthy romantic gestures. Pair that with a fierce overprotective vibe, a fake marriage (hello...forced proximity of having to live together for "authenticity") and the celebrity gossip circuit & lifestyle. But best of all is the vulnerabilities of two people giving themselves permission to be their authentically messy selves. She has always been the calm to his storm, his soft place to land and his voice of reason in the chaos. Now...he just wants to be hers! (Swoon)
